WU19s set to discover EURO opponents

The draw for the 2024 UEFA Women's Under-19 Championships takes place on Tuesday, April 30 at 17:00 in Lithuania.

After topping Group A2 in Round 2 of qualifying, Ireland are back in these finals tournament for the first time since 2014 - when they reached the semi-finals.

There will be eight teams split over two groups competing in three different venues in Kaunas, Jonava and Marijampole. The top two teams from each group will progress to the semi-finals.

The tournament will start on July 14th and run through to the final on July 27th.

Ireland could be drawn against any of: England, France, Germany, Lithuania, Netherlands, Serbia or Spain.
